Microsoft will not close the vulnerability found in the browser

By Prempal Singh 0 Comment September 11, 2017

Security specialists from Cisco discovered a vulnerability that exists in all popular browsers,including Chrome, Safari and Edge. Unlike Google and Apple, which have already released patches, Microsoft has not done so. They believe that this is not a bug, but a browser. Hackers published an ANB bookmark for Windows-based systems

By Prempal Singh 0 Comment September 11, 2017

The sensational hacking group The Shadow Brokers again reminded of itself. This time, the hackers published an instruction for the exploit of the US National Security Agency under the name UNITEDRAKE and announced some changes in the work of their service to provide stolen data. One in five children face online abuse. This is how parents can fight back

By Karnveer Singh 0 Comment September 5, 2017

According to Teens, Tweens and Technology study 2015, conducted by Intel Security 81 percent of Indian children aged eight 8 and 16 are active on social media networks, and about 22 percent of them are bullied online.
